Runbook: Fennwick Library catalogue import

Future maintainers: the importer ingests MARC batches nightly, validating each record against the Fennwick schema before upsert. Duplicate accession numbers are quarantined, never overwritten, and a reconciliation report is written per batch. Re-running a failed batch is safe and idempotent. Before any manual run, confirm the importer is using these configuration values.

settings of yaguf-bahip:
druwyn:
  log_level: debug
  metrics_host: metrics.druwyn.qorvelsys.internal
  pool_size: 32

Plugin authors: we've had reports that the Duskhollow firmware update channel occasionally serves a delta package built against the wrong base version, so devices on the beta ring reject the patch and fall back to full images. Annoying, but harmless. Until the channel fix ships, pin your plugin's minimum firmware to the last stable ring release and avoid delta-only manifests. If you want to cross-check whether your device pulled the bad delta, compare against the token below.

pipeline stamp: htk9_ce63042d9

### Step 4: Repoint the proctoring queue

Once the Vantlemoor exam-proctoring queue has drained on the old cluster, stop the intake workers and flip the consumer group to the new broker set. Sessions already in review are unaffected; only new exam submissions route through the replacement queue. Expect a two-to-three minute gap in assignment while consumers rebalance. Before restarting, apply the settings for the new cluster, which are as follows.

service settings:
[briius]
port = 3000
region = outer-1
host = briius.zarqeldyn.internal
team = wenael
timeout_ms = 2000
retries = 5

Subject: Sweeper cut-over complete

Hi Marguerite,

The orphaned-resource sweeper on Hollowgate finished cut-over last night. Old cron-based sweeps are disabled and the new event-driven sweeper has run clean for twelve hours. No orphans missed in the reconciliation report. Rollback window closes Friday. For the release record, the active production configuration is shown below.

service settings:
PRAIX_LOG_LEVEL=error
PRAIX_METRICS_HOST=metrics.praix.qorvelcorp.corp
PRAIX_POOL_SIZE=16